Is Southington, Connecticut Safe?
Southington, a Hartford County town, is known for its annual Apple Harvest Festival. Its suburban landscape is largely residential, with a population exceeding 43,000.
Southington has a safety score of 54/100 (Near National Average). Based on FBI data, the city reported a total crime rate of 1,580.4 per 100,000 residents, compared to the national average of 2,785.9 per 100,000.
Southington ranks #53 out of 82 cities in Connecticut and #1363 out of 2957 nationally (safest first). This places it in the 54th percentile for safety — safer than 54% of US cities.
All major crime categories in Southington are below the national average, with murder particularly low at 0.0x the national rate.
Year over year, Southington's total crime rate decreased by 22.6%, with violent crime rising 70.8%.

Southington Crime Statistics Breakdown
| Crime Type | Incidents | Rate per 100K | National Avg |
|---|---|---|---|
| Violent Crime | 29 | 66.1 | 478.2 |
| Murder | 0 | 0.0 | 6.3 |
| Rape | 4 | 9.1 | 43.8 |
| Robbery | 18 | 41.1 | 94.0 |
| Aggravated Assault | 7 | 16.0 | 333.5 |
| Property Crime | 664 | 1,514.3 | 2,307.7 |
| Burglary | 78 | 177.9 | 292.0 |
| Larceny-Theft | 541 | 1,233.8 | 1,657.7 |
| Motor Vehicle Theft | 45 | 102.6 | 358.0 |
| Arson | 0 | 0.0 | 0.0 |
Southington vs Connecticut Average
How does Southington's crime rate compare to the Connecticut state average?
| Metric | Southington | Connecticut Avg |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Violent Crime Rate | 66.1 | 160.0 | -58.7% |
| Property Crime Rate | 1,514.3 | 1,594.2 | -5.0% |
| Murder Rate | 0.0 | 2.7 | -100.0% |
| Total Crime Rate | 1,580.4 | 1,754.1 | -9.9% |
Southington Crime Rate Trends
Year-over-year crime rate changes for Southington, Connecticut.
| Year | Coverage | Total Crime Rate | Violent Crime Rate | Property Crime Rate |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2024 | 43,849 | 1,580.4 | 66.1 | 1,514.3 |
| 2023 | 43,900 | 2,041.0 | 38.7 | 2,002.3 |
| 2022 | 43,564 | 1,907.5 | 59.7 | 1,847.9 |
| 2021 | 43,897 | 1,931.8 | 86.6 | 1,845.2 |
| 2020 | 43,906 | 2,154.6 | 59.2 | 2,095.4 |
| 2019 | 43,886 | 1,294.3 | 59.2 | 1,235.0 |
